Al Jaber & Partners (AJP) has completed ten-million man-hours without a single lost-time incident (LTI) at Lusail City in Qatar.
"It is a great achievement," said Lusail Real Estate Development Company CEO Eng. Essa Mohammed Ali Kaldari.
AJP MD Mohammad Jawhar received a certificate and trophy in the presence of senior officials at a ceremony to celebrate the achievement.
Lusail City's Construction Package No.2, Known as Fox Hill North and Hill South, is located in the heart of Lusail City, comprising an 180ha area.
The work associated with Fox Hills includes roads, potable water, sewer, stormwater and irrigation network, electrical network, district cooling and gas network, electrical substations and pumping stations.
